Transaction efb58106fb7836c9bdcf9e1b21f161cbd38ede0d73fbfb2cad27559f9db62357

1 Input
2 Outputs
  • efb58106fb7836c9bdcf9e1b21f161cbd38ede0d73fbfb2cad27559f9db62357:0
  • value  359025
    address  37o8RGm2rYkV5QWV9BwNtSzpS28KGoMcA4
  • efb58106fb7836c9bdcf9e1b21f161cbd38ede0d73fbfb2cad27559f9db62357:1
  • value  340373
    address  3PbJsixkjmjzsjCpi4xAYxxaL5NnxrbF9B